Last week, Native Instruments released Massive X, the eagerly anticipated follow-up to 2007’s Massive softsynth. Point Blank has now released a tutorial video that gives an overview of the new synth’s oscillators, signal flow and more.

Undertaken by Chris Carter, Point Blank’s Module Leader for Sound Design, the overview’s first half zooms in on the two wavetable oscillators and noise oscillator section. Carter demonstrates how to morph waveforms and search for different wavetables, before highlighting some interesting sounds offered by the two identical noise oscillators.

The next half of the overview focuses on both insert and send effects, the various modulation sources, presets and the intuitive routing engine.
